Standing Stone, near Pandy

Standing Stone

What is recorded here

The National Monuments Record of Wales records Standing Stone, near Pandy as Standing Stone from the Unknown period. The saved point comes from the official national record. Inclusion does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Standing Stone, near Pandy is likely to date from the Bronze Age, a period when such stones were often erected for ritual, territorial, or commemorative purposes. Its specific meaning or use remains unrecorded, though local folklore sometimes associates standing stones with ancient legends or protective functions.
